← Back to context

Comment by Grombobulous

5 hours ago

As long as the VM closes when the application closes, I don’t see too much of an issue with this design decision.

It seems like the VM is a core part of how you use the application.

Apart from you have no idea what's going on in the VM. It's not as it has a virtual terminal. I'll play the skeptic archetype: What's not to say they're transmitting all prompts back HQ?

Don't be naive and don't think they don't already do this.

Why not ask itself and see what it says about it. "Claude, why are you running in a virtual machine and what are you doing?".

/shrug

  • Claude transmits all prompts back to HQ as a part of its basic functionality.

    If you are using an AI system to read your codebase from your local folder and make changes, whether or not you have a VM running or not is inconsequential. The Claude extension and/or CLI doesn’t need a VM to send code back to the mothership, you’re already running an executable program and granting it directory access.

    Whether you trust a company as a vendor is typically based on their privacy policy, EULA, and your contract with them (if applicable). Those are the bits that have legal enforceability.